Course Details
• Community Health Assessment: Understanding the health needs and assets of a community through data collection, analysis, and interpretation.
• Health Promotion Strategies: Designing, implementing, and evaluating evidence-based health promotion programs to improve community health and well-being.
• Cultural Competence in Health Care: Developing cultural awareness, knowledge, and skills to provide effective and respectful health care services to diverse populations.
• Chronic Disease Prevention and Management: Identifying risk factors, prevention strategies, and management options for chronic diseases, such as diabetes, heart disease, and cancer.
• Mental Health and Well-being: Recognizing the signs and symptoms of mental health disorders, promoting mental health literacy, and reducing stigma.
• Substance Use and Addiction: Understanding the impact of substance use and addiction on community health, and implementing harm reduction strategies.
• Health Policy and Advocacy: Analyzing health policies and advocating for equitable and accessible health care services for all community members.
• Community Engagement and Partnership: Building trust, fostering relationships, and collaborating with community stakeholders to improve health outcomes.
• Evaluation and Research Methods: Applying research methods and evaluation strategies to assess the impact and effectiveness of community health interventions.
